[Dynamic double contrast small bowel enema (author's transl)].
Summary
A new infusion system improves double contrast imaging of the small bowel. This technique enhances visualization of the ileum, a previously difficult area to examine, with reduced complications over time.

Background:
- Conventional double contrast techniques have limitations in visualizing the entire small bowel.
- The ileum, in particular, is often poorly demonstrated with existing methods.
Purpose of the Study:
- To describe a modified double contrast technique for small bowel examination.
- To evaluate the efficacy of a novel infusion system for improved small bowel imaging.
Main Methods:
- A modified double contrast technique using an infusion system with variable pressure control.
- Separate adjustment of contrast medium, methyl cellulose, and water flow.
- Continuous double contrast demonstration of the entire small bowel.
Main Results:
- The modified technique allows for satisfactory demonstration of the ileum in 70% of cases.
- Continuous double contrast imaging of the entire small bowel is achievable.
- Initial frequent side effects and failures became less common with experience.
Conclusions:
- The modified double contrast technique with variable infusion pressure offers improved visualization of the small bowel, especially the ileum.
- This method enhances diagnostic capabilities for small bowel conditions.
- Experience with the technique leads to a reduction in adverse events and technical failures.
